Herring, Potato and Dill Salad Recipe

Inspired by Eastern European cuisine, this recipe takes herrings and combines them with potatoes, sour cream, pickles and mayonnaise. The resulting dish is hearty yet not too heavy, and very tasty.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4
Course: Starter
Cuisine: Eastern European

Ingredients
 

  • 6 tablespoons mayonnaise
  • 1 kg (2 lbs) new potatoes
  • 560 g (1 lb) sweet, cured herrings, drained and cut into 2 cm strips
  • 8 pickled gherkins (green pickles), sliced thinly
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h dill
  • 2 tablespoons sour cream
  • Salt and black pepper, to taste

Method
 

  1. Boil the potatoes until tender, drain and cut into wedges.
  2. Combine the mayonnaise, sour cream and dill in a large bowl.
  3. Season this mixture with salt and pepper.
  4. Put the gherkins, potatoes and herrings into a bowl with the dressing.
  5. Toss well, check the seasoning once more, and then serve.
